Benevento: The City of Witches and Ancient Wonders

Benevento is a city steeped in legend and history, famously known as the 'City of Witches.' This moniker stems from ancient Sabbat rituals said to have taken place under a walnut tree, a tradition that has woven itself into the city's folklore. Beyond its mystical reputation, Benevento holds a surprising connection to ancient Egypt. After Rome, it's noted as a city outside of Egypt with a significant number of Egyptian artifacts, largely due to its importance as a center for Egyptian religion during Roman times. TikTok+1

Exploring Benevento offers a unique blend of the mythical and the historical. Visitors can wander through its charming streets, discover Roman ruins like the Arch of Trajan, and delve into the city's past at local museums that house these fascinating Egyptian relics. The city's location also makes it a point of interest for those tracing ancient routes, such as the Appian Way. TikTok
